Al Lee's "Time" is a record in poetry of life in the '60 hard on the politics, funny on sex, radical, passionate, cool, vulgar, and high-spirited. Includes "Pem for the Year Twenty Twenty". Lee was the Editor of the important anthology "Major Young Poets", 1971.
